How many trains are there in India in 2020?

Indian Railways is among the world’s largest rail network, and its route length network is spread over 1,23,236 kms, with 13,523 passenger trains and 9,146 freight trains, plying 23 million travellers and 3 million tonnes (MT) of freight daily from 7,349 stations.

Can I buy a train in India?

No you cannot buy a train in India. You can get railway coaches which will be auctioned once they are thrown away as condemned. In tenders colum of each Railway, you can check up for the forthcoming auctions. But, the auction will be for generally a bigger quantity.

Who is biggest railway station in India?

Longest Railway Platform in India:

The platform at Gorakhpur Railway Station in Uttar Pradesh is the world’s longest station, measuring a whopping 1,366 m. The record was previously held by the platform at Kharagpur station in West Bengal at 1,072 m.

Which train has longest route in India?

On board the Vivek Express, India’s longest train journey, covering 9 states in 5 days. India’s longest train journey begins at Dibrugarh in Assam, and ends at the country’s southernmost point — Kanyakumari, in Tamil Nadu.

Which one is the fastest train in India?

The Vande Bharat Express is India’s fastest train, with a capacity to attain a speed of over 180 kmph during it trial runs. On the Delhi-Varanasi route, however, the section speed restrictions are in place which does not allow the train to exceed a maximum speed of 130 kmph.
